Why Hire a Professional Back Door Installer?Expertise and Experience
Professional installers have the technical skills and experience to guarantee that the back entrance is fitted correctly. They comprehend the nuances of door installation, including how to appropriately line up the door frame, adjust hinges, and guarantee that the door operates smoothly.
Time Efficiency
Installing a back entrance can be a time-consuming undertaking, particularly for those unknown with the process. Professionals can typically complete the installation much faster, permitting property owners to resume their typical regimens without considerable disruption.
Warranty and Guarantees
Many professional installation services offer warranties on their work. This not only protects your financial investment but also provides peace of mind knowing that the work is ensured.
Access to Quality Materials
Professional installers often have great relationships with providers, giving them access to high-quality doors and products that might not be readily available to the average customer.

Frequently asked questions
Q: How much does it generally cost to hire a back door installer?A: Costs can vary commonly
based upon region, door type, and installer experience. Usually, installation expenses can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000. Q: How long does it require to set up a back door?A: A common back door installation can take anywhere
from 2 to 4 hours depending on the intricacy of the job. Q: Do I require to acquire a license for back door installation?A: Permit requirementscan differ by location. It's a good idea to contact your local building department before beginning any installation. Q: Can back doors be energy efficient?A: Absolutely! Numerous contemporary back doors are designed with energy-efficient products and
insulation, which can help in reducing heating
